Materials That Separate a Good Closet from a Great One

Here’s something most companies won’t tell you directly: the material is where quality lives.

Thermally Fused Laminate (TFL) is our primary recommendation for most residential closets. It’s moisture-resistant, easy to maintain, and built to handle daily use without warping or wearing down. It also looks great – clean edges, consistent finish, and a wide range of color options.

Melamine costs less, but you tend to feel that difference within the first few years. It chips more easily, absorbs moisture, and doesn’t hold up as well under real load.

For Youngstown Ohio clients seeking an elevated, furniture-grade look, we incorporate solid wood or wood-veneer panels. Combined with aluminum hardware and soft-close mechanisms, these closets feel less like storage units and more like a room in themselves.

Common Mistakes We See – And How We Prevent Them

After years in this business, we’ve seen the same mistakes show up again and again. Not because homeowners make bad decisions, but because closet design has a learning curve most people never need to climb.

Over-allocating to hanging space is the biggest one. Most wardrobes have far more folded items, shoes, and accessories than they have hanging items. When a closet is designed with mostly hanging rods, all of that other stuff gets crammed onto one shelf or ends up on the floor.

Ignoring vertical space is close behind. The average reach-in closet stops using vertical space around five feet. But most ceilings go to eight or nine. That’s two to four feet of unused storage in every closet that was never designed properly.

Prioritizing looks over function is a real trap. A beautiful closet that doesn’t work is just an expensive frustration. We balance both – because the best closets are ones you still love using five years from now.

    FAQ:

    What is the difference between a custom closet system and a standard closet organizer?

    A standard closet organizer uses pre-made, fixed-dimension components that are configured to approximate your space. A custom closet system is designed and fabricated specifically for your closet’s exact measurements, your storage inventory, and your preferences. Custom systems maximize space utilization to a degree that standard organizers cannot achieve, and they are built with higher-grade materials that last significantly longer.

    How much does closet remodeling typically cost?

    Closet remodeling costs depend on the size of the closet, the complexity of the design, the materials selected, and the number of specialty components like drawers, pull-outs, and lighting. Reach-in closet remodels generally start at several hundred dollars for smaller configurations and scale upward for larger or more complex designs. Walk-in closets with full custom built components, integrated drawers, and specialty hardware represent a broader range. Always request an itemized quote that specifies materials and dimensions so you can compare accurately.

    Can a small closet benefit from a custom organizer system?

    Yes, and in many cases, small closets see the most dramatic improvement from a custom organizer system. Because every inch matters in a small space, the precision of a custom design, which uses the full height of the wall, eliminates wasted corner space, and adds vertical storage zones, can effectively double the usable capacity of a closet without expanding its footprint. A well-designed small closet organizer addresses what standard configurations always miss: the space above and below the standard single-rod setup.

    How long does professional closet installation take?

    For most residential closets, professional installation is completed in a single day. Larger walk-in closets with complex configurations, island units, or integrated lighting may require two days. The design and fabrication process takes longer, typically one to two weeks from approved design to installation day, depending on the company’s production schedule. The installation day itself is relatively non-disruptive, and the closet is fully functional immediately upon completion.

    What should I ask a closet remodeling company before hiring them?

    Ask about the specific panel material and thickness they use, what brand of drawer slides and hinges they install, whether the design is fully custom or based on semi-custom components, how the installation is anchored to walls, what their warranty covers and for how long, and whether you will see a rendered design before fabrication begins. A quality closet remodeling company answers all of these questions clearly and without deflection. Vague answers about materials or a reluctance to provide client references are meaningful warning signs.
